Around the worldE-book As we can send mail by email, we can read books by e-book now. E-books first appeared in the 1990s and have made great improvement in technology. Notes can be written on the e-book, new books can be easily downloaded from the Internet, and it’s muchEasier and quicker to search for passages. What’s More, a lot of paper will be saved. Nowadays, the most Advanced e-book is about 620g, 18cm long, 12cmwide and 2cm thick. It looks like a real book. But the E-book is more expensive than paper books, so not many people can afford it. However, with the rapid progress of electronic technology, the e-book will become more convenient and cheaper. It is said that in the near future, there will be more e-books than paper books.
